**Sweeper stuck on orphaned volumes.** If the Gravelpond sweeper logs "skip: owner ref missing" repeatedly, it usually means the reconciler crashed mid-delete and left dangling claims. Run the sweeper manually with `--force-adopt` against the staging cluster first and confirm the deletion count matches the audit log. The manual run requires authenticating against the Gravelpond control API. Use the following bearer token for that call.

portal login ticket: eyJhbGciOiJIUzI1NiIsInR5cCI6IkpXVCJ9.eyJzdWIiOiIwEOsktwVNwIn0.-UJU3fdyyCgG

## Onboarding: Fareweight Rules Engine

Fareweight computes shipping fees from stacked rule sets. Rules are versioned; never edit a live version. Deploys go through the staging evaluator first. Read the rule DSL guide before touching anything.

Rule definitions live in the pricing database — connect to it with the connection string below.

primary connection of yagep-bajop = postgresql://druiel_svc:gW@db-3860.sivrelworks.example:5432/brieth

## Offline mode — TerraTally field app

When surveyors lose signal out past the Kellerbrook ridge sites, TerraTally flips to offline mode and queues submissions in local storage. Don't panic if the sync badge goes red — it clears on reconnect. If queued records exceed 500, nudge the crew to sync over depot wifi. Before filing a bug, grab the build stamp shown below.

build token for bajog-yaduf: htk9_39788324c

## Introduce per-tenant rate quotas in the Orvane gateway

For the release manager: this change replaces our global throttle with per-tenant quotas, resolved at request time from the tenant registry and cached for sixty seconds. Tenants without an explicit quota inherit the tier default; overage returns a retryable status with a hint header. Rollout is gated behind a flag, defaulting off, and the old throttle remains as a backstop until two clean release cycles pass.

The initial tier defaults we intend to ship are listed below.

limits module of taguf-hafog:
WEIGHTS = {
    "wenox": 690,
    "wenok": 782,
    "kelax": 41,
    "holox": 338,
    "quenir": 39,
}